The Division of Vascular Surgery at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ill is proud to offer a fully accredited 5-year integrated residency program, which residents enter directly from medical school. Students at North American medical schools may apply for the program through the Electronic Residency Application Service (ERAS). - Trainees would devote three years to vascular surgery and two years to core surgical training.
